ALSA: hda/cirrus_scodec_test: Fix incorrect setup of gpiochip

[ Upstream commit c5e96e54eca3876d4ce8857e2e22adbe9f44f4a2 ]

Set gpiochip parent to the struct device of the dummy GPIO driver
so that the software node will be associated with the GPIO chip.

The recent commit e5d527be7e698 ("gpio: swnode: don't use the
swnode's name as the key for GPIO lookup") broke cirrus_scodec_test,
because the software node no longer gets associated with the GPIO
driver by name.

Instead, setting struct gpio_chip.parent to the owning struct device
will find the node using a normal fwnode lookup.
